linux系统启动脚本命令

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ux系统启动脚本命令通常称为初始化脚本或服务脚本,用于在系统启动时执行特定的操作或运行特定的服务。下面是一些常用的Linux系统启动脚本命令:

    1. service:用于启动、停止、重新启动、重载或查看服务状态。例如,使用”service apache2 start”命令启动Apache Web服务器。

    2. systemctl:用于管理系统的systemd服务。例如,使用”systemctl start nginx”命令启动Nginx Web服务器。

    3. chkconfig:用于管理在系统启动时自动运行的服务。例如,使用”chkconfig –add httpd”命令将Apache服务添加到系统启动项。

    4. init.d:包含系统启动脚本的目录。这些脚本通常以”/etc/init.d/”开头,用于启动、停止或重启特定的服务。

    5. rc.d:类似于init.d目录,用于存储系统启动脚本的目录。这些脚本通常以”/etc/rc.d/”开头,并在系统启动时执行。

    6. /etc/rc.local:是一个脚本文件,在系统启动过程中最后一个被执行。可以在这个文件中添加自定义的命令或脚本。

    除了以上列举的命令,不同的Linux发行版可能还有其他特定的启动脚本命令。如果使用的是特定的发行版,建议查阅相关文档或手册以获得更准确的信息。另外,对于个别服务或应用程序,也可能有自己独立的启动脚本命令,请参考相应的文档或手册。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Linux系统的启动脚本命令主要是用于在系统启动时自动执行指定的操作。下面列举了一些常用的Linux启动脚本命令:

    1. /etc/rc.d/rc.local:这是一个自定义启动脚本命令,用于在系统启动过程结束后执行。可以在其中添加一些需要在每次系统启动时执行的命令。

    2. /etc/init.d/:该目录中存放着系统服务的启动脚本。每个服务都有对应的启动脚本,以实现在系统启动时自动启动相应的服务。

    3. update-rc.d:这是Debian系列的系统中用于管理系统服务的工具。可以使用update-rc.d命令来控制系统服务的启动顺序、启用或禁用指定的服务等。

    4. systemctl:这是Systemd管理系统服务的命令。可以使用systemctl命令来管理、控制和监视系统服务的状态、启用或禁用指定服务等。

    5. cron:cron是一种用于执行预定时间的任务的工具。通过编辑cron表达式,可以设置定时任务,使其在系统启动时运行特定的命令。

    这些是仅仅列举了一些常用的Linux系统启动脚本命令。在实际应用中,根据不同的Linux发行版和系统版本,可能使用的启动脚本命令会有所区别。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ux系统的启动脚本命令有很多种,下面我将结合不同的操作流程来介绍一些常见的启动脚本命令。

    1. sysvinit启动脚本命令
    sysvinit是Linux系统中最常见的初始化系统,它采用了基于脚本的方式来管理系统的初始化、运行级别切换和服务管理。

    1.1 启动命令
    在sysvinit中,启动脚本命令以”/etc/init.d/”目录下的脚本文件为基础,使用以下命令进行启动:
    “`
    /etc/init.d/service-name start
    “`
    其中,service-name为具体的服务名,比如apache2、mysql等。

    1.2 停止命令
    停止服务的命令与启动命令类似,可以使用以下命令:
    “`
    /etc/init.d/service-name stop
    “`

    1.3 重启命令
    重启服务的命令与启动和停止命令类似,可以使用以下命令:
    “`
    /etc/init.d/service-name restart
    “`

    1.4 查询状态命令
    查询服务的状态可以使用以下命令:
    “`
    /etc/init.d/service-name status
    “`

    1.5 设置开机自启动
    在sysvinit中,要设置服务开机自启动,需要使用chkconfig命令,具体命令如下:
    “`
    chkconfig service-name on
    “`
    其中,service-name为具体的服务名。

    2. systemd启动脚本命令
    systemd是Linux系统中较新的初始化系统,它使用单一的配置文件和单一的命令进行管理,相较于sysvinit更为灵活和高效。

    2.1 启动命令
    在systemd中,启动服务的命令为:
    “`
    systemctl start service-name
    “`

    2.2 停止命令
    停止服务的命令为:
    “`
    systemctl stop service-name
    “`

    2.3 重启命令
    重启服务的命令为:
    “`
    systemctl restart service-name
    “`

    2.4 查询状态命令
    查询服务状态的命令为:
    “`
    systemctl status service-name
    “`

    2.5 设置开机自启动
    在systemd中,要设置服务开机自启动,可以使用以下命令:
    “`
    systemctl enable service-name
    “`

    以上就是关于Linux系统中常见的启动脚本命令的介绍。不同的Linux发行版可能存在一些差异,但基本思想和操作流程是类似的。希望对你有帮助!

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部